The absolute zero pressure can be attained at a temperature of

A 0°C
B -273°C
C 273 K
D None of these

Correct Answer: -273°C

Correct Option is (B)
The lower the temperature, the lower the pressure inside of the sphere.
If the exact values were plotted out, a linear relationship would be apparent.
Extrapolating this line to the point where there would be no pressure yields absolute zero, which is about -273.15 degrees Celsius.
